Amaranthe – Boomerang 

This is the new single from Amaranthe, taken from their fourth album ‘Maximalism’ released last autumn. Founder member Jake E features on the track but is notably absent from the video having recently announced his departure from the band.

Depeche Mode – Where’s The Revolution 

This Anton Corbijn directed video is the first single from Depeche Mode’s new album ‘Spirit’, which is released on 17th March. The band play London’s Wembley Stadium on June 3rd.

Peter Gabriel – Shock The Monkey 

The Progfather himself, Peter Gabriel, celebrates his birthday this week (13th February 1950), so here’s a track from his fourth eponymous album, released in 1982.
